Resumo | |
The so-called 'New Massive Gravity' in consists of the Einstein-Hilbert action (with minus sign) plus a quadratic term in the curvature (-term). Here we perform the Kaluza-Klein dimensional reduction of the linearized -term to . We end up with fourth-order massive electrodynamics in , described by a rank-2 tensor. Remarkably, there appears a local symmetry in , which persists even after gauging away the Stueckelberg fields of the dimensional reduction. It plays the role of a gauge symmetry. Although of higher order in the derivatives, the new 2D massive electrodynamics is ghost free, as we show here. It is shown, via a master action, to be dual to the Maxwell-Proca theory with a scalar Stueckelberg field. (AU) | |
